gpt4 book ai didi

javascript - AngularJS 显示元素 onScroll 函数

转载 作者:行者123 更新时间:2023-12-03 02:58:43 25 4
gpt4 key购买 nike

这是我们的 JavaScript:

window.onscroll=function(){scrollShow()};
function scrollShow(){
if (document.documentElement.scrollTop>150){
document.getElementById("myBtn").style.display="block";
} else {
document.getElementById("myBtn").style.display="none";
}
}

如何在 AngularJS 中实现相同的功能?

最佳答案

您可以通过创建指令来做到这一点

<button id='myBtn' scroll-show></div>

app.directive('scrollShow', [function() {
return {
link: function (scope, elem, attrs) {
elem.on('scroll', function (e) {
if(....) {
element.hide();
} else {
element.show();
}
});
})
}
}]);

关于javascript - AngularJS 显示元素 onScroll 函数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/47507169/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com